This may be utterly naive sounding (I am no military expert) but...

If squads receive a bonus for being in contact with the Platoon HQ unit, then shouldn't the PLatoon HQ units get a bonus if they are in contact with the Company HQ? (which would also benefit the squads)

It always seems like the COmpany HQ ends up hanging out in back with the arty spotters.

Could someone explain why it is the way it is? I just don't get it (admittedly becuase I don't know jack about this area). It seems to me like the Company HQ units should be more invovled in the actual combat. What what their historical role? How should I be using them?

Historically, the company HQ would sit back and let the platoon HQs direct their men in the fighting. A company headquarters is primarily administrative - the company first sergeant/company sergeant major/hauptfeldwebel or whatever you want to call the top NCO in the company handles stuff like POW collection, ammo distribution, paperwork, etc. The company HQ also has the company commander, second in command, company clerk, signalmen, drivers, storemen and all the guys whose job it is to support the riflemen in the platoons.

I am a company clerk in the Canadian Army reserve currently; but the role of a company HQ hasn't changed much in the last 100 years, nor from army to army. In actual combat conditions it would not be unusual to see the company commander in action but usually in a desperate battle, perhaps if officers and NCOs took a lot of casualties and a platoon was lacking leadership, but in most cases, officers tend to move up - ie a company commander taking over a battalion or a squad leader taking over a platoon.
